htmlentities

wenco

Erfahrenes Mitglied
Hallo,
ich habe ein Kontaktformular und behandele alle input-felder (aus sicherheitsgründen) mit
-htmlentities
-nl2br
-usw.
jetzt tritt das Problem auf, dass die Umlaute in den E-Mail-Texten auch mit der html-Entsprechung dargestellt werden, also ein ö statt ö....., das will ich natürlich nicht.
Muss / kann man das da enstprechend zurückwandeln?
Ich habe gelesen, dass html_entity_decode erst ab PHP 4.3.0 greift...
Danke!
 
Danke,
werd ich ausprobiern.(..sieht ganz schön kompliziert aus...)

Kann es sein, dass man, wenn php 5 läuft, garnicht mehr zurück-entcoden muss?
Hab nämlich noch ne andere Site (php 5) und da mache ich dasselbe, aber in den Mailtexten werden ohne mein zutun die Umlaute etc., richtig dargestellt.

Außerdem habe ich noch noch ne Frage. Wenn ich nl2br auf eine Textarea anwende und die Seite wird noch mal aufgerufen (wegen Fehlermeldung etc) erscheinen die <br> in der texarea. Was kann man dagegen denn tut?

T'schuldigung, hab nich so viel Ahnung...
 
Zurück